Saturday morning I birded a large tract of privately-owned property in the 
Peach Creek Community in southern Brazos County. My main objective was to check 
a marshy area for nesting Common Yellowthroat. A male was vigorously defending 
a territory three weeks ago. The bird was in the same location yesterday and 
singing vigorously and making scolding calls. I have yet to see a female or 
young in the marsh. A second male yellowthroat was observed singing in the 
marsh about 100 yards away from the other male.
 
A Willow Flycatcher called in the rattlebush in the marsh. I heard the fitz-bew 
and wit calls. There was another silent Traill's flycatcher in the rattlebush. 
A pair of Wood Ducks, a silent Prothonotary Warbler, and a Red-headed 
Woodpecker were also in the area. Most of the expected long-legged wading birds 
were represented on the property. Great Blue Heron, 4 Great Egrets, Snowy 
Egret, adult Little Blue Heron, Green Heron, adult and immature Yellow-crowned 
Night Heron, and 4 White Ibis.
 
Ruby-throated Hummingbirds were feeding on trumpet vine blooms.  One 
Yellow-throated Vireo sang briefly. A couple of Northern Parulas and a 
Black-and-white Warbler were foraging in the crowns of overcup oak trees. A 
pair of Summer Tanagers were foraging together and the male sang a little bit. 
Indigo Buntings were singing all over the property. Probably 8 males, including 
one singing in flight. I saw two females. A couple of Painted Buntings were 
still singing. I saw a total of 3 adult males and one female. Lastly, one adult 
male and three female/immature type Orchard Orioles migrated throh the property.
 
All in all, not a bad morning in the field on a late July day. There was a 
light north breeze, overcast skies, and the temperature was 84 degrees when I 
left the property shortly before noon.
